Job summary

A prominent financial regulatory body seeks a Corporate Compliance and Thematic Manager for a 12-month secondment. The role involves leading a high-performing team in compliance and market integrity, managing case investigations, and overseeing ESG-related issues. Candidates should have relevant experience in capital markets and stakeholder management. This position offers a salary ranging from £72,100 to £117,100 (£79,300 to £128,800 in London), with a hybrid work model.

Benefits

28 days annual leave
Hybrid working up to 60%
Non-contributory pension
Private healthcare
Paid volunteering allowance
Flexible benefits scheme

Qualifications

  • Experience in primary markets investigations or listed company regulatory work is essential.
  • Strong understanding of the UK listing and market abuse regimes.
  • Ability to manage multiple cases and projects effectively.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the CCT team, setting strategic direction and aligning with objectives.
  • Oversee compliance and casework under the UK listing regime.
  • Drive strategic and thematic priorities, identifying emerging risks.
  • Manage ESG and sustainability-related cases efficiently.
  • Develop and embed a data and knowledge strategy enhancing decision-making.
  • Represent the CCT team in key forums and policy discussions.
